Relaxation to recovery
Today’s consumers know that recovery is more than unwinding after a busy day and are seeking treatments to help them achieve a physiological and psychological reset.

Metawell’s mind-body wellness technologies are designed with this in mind. Touchless and fully-automated, they offer consistent experiences for guests while optimising staff resources. Some integrate seamlessly with traditional spa services, complementing the human touch and allowing operators to expand their menus with innovative, evidence-based options.

The physical benefits of recovery technologies are well-documented. Modalities such as far-infrared (MLX i3Dome), Intermittent Vacuum Therapy (G-Vac), and sound or hydrotherapy (Zestós DryFloat) can reduce muscular tension, support lymphatic drainage and assist detoxification. These processes are vital in lowering inflammation – a key contributor to fatigue, pain and accelerated ageing.

When inflammation is managed and circulation improves, the immune system is strengthened. People ‘bounce back’ faster, with more energy and resilience after stress, exercise or travel. By offering technologies that directly support immune function, spas align with one of today’s top wellness priorities.

Recovery requires shifting into the parasympathetic state, where the nervous system rests and restores balance. Binaural Vibroacoustic technologies, such as the RLX Satori Mental Fitness lounger or Welnamis, trigger this response in a single treatment.
